Carolinas Magazine Article about Sportscenter Athletic Club.“More Than Just A Gym” was a phrase that resonated with Sammy Johnson for many years prior to opening his first athletic club. Being a member of numerous facilities that offered merely weight lifting, cardio equipment and aerobic classes, he had a vision of a one-stop upscale club that offered a wellness environment that would encompass the fitness needs of a broad customer base. He had a dream of opening a “country club” type facility that would offer any and all types of fitness opportunities for its clients, thus Sportscenter Athletic Club was born.

After Sammy retired from playing in the NFL he decided to pursue his dream. The first athletic club was built in 1982 in Concord, North Carolina. At that time, Concord was not a likely choice for such a club; however this was the hometown of Sammy’s wife Linda. The athletic club is still there today and has proven to be a successful business model.

Sportscenter Athletic Club facilities in High Point and Kernersville.

Sammy Johnson wasn’t looking to build another athletic club, but an opportunity presented itself in High Point, North Carolina. Sammy was a High Point native and a number of his high school friends and fellow UNC graduates who were now prominent business men in the area approached him with a proposal. They wanted him to bring the vision to the Triad. After careful consideration, he decided to proceed. He relocated his entire family to High Point. This included his wife Linda, eldest son Sam, daughter Kelly, and youngest son Matt. The Sportscenter High Point opened in 2000 and at 75,000 square feet is one of the largest privately owned athletic clubs on the entire east coast. The amenities include: four racquetball courts, four tennis courts, two basketball courts, a state-of-the-art weight room, 100 pieces of cardio equipment, aerobics studio, cycling studio, yoga/pilates studio, indoor track, two steam rooms, two saunas, whirlpool, indoor lap pool, indoor activity pool, outdoor pool, outdoor kiddie pool, two outdoor sand volleyball courts, an indoor volleyball court, massage therapist, internet cafe and lounge, teenage game room, and nursery. The club has been successful in the High Point area and Sammy thought that it would be his last athletic club, but yet another opportunity presented itself.

In August 2011 Sportscenter Athletic Club acquired the local Gold’s Gym’s in the triad adding yet another location for it’s members. Located on Battleground Avenue, it’s second location is comprised of close to 30,000 square feet of fitness goodness. Facility amenities for the new Greensboro Club include the following: weight machines, free weights, cardiovascular equipment, a cardio cinema movie theater, Les Mills group fitness classes, free childcare, locker facilities, sauna, personal training, and massage therapy.
